Book excerpt: Formal methods (FMs) are intended to provide the means for greater precision in both thinking and documenting the preliminary stage of the software creation process When done well, this can aid all aspects of software creation user requirement formulation, implementation, verification testing, and the creation of documentation However, the maturing of formal techniques into real life software engineering involves providing notations and tools that are readily understood and used by practitioners, and the integration of such tools with activities that are far from the unrealistic assumptions that characterized some earlier research in formal methods

It combines the best of theory and practice and contains recipes for increasing the output of our productivity sectors. The idea of improving software quality through reuse is not new. After all, if software works and is needed, why not simply reuse it? What is new and evolving, however, is the idea of relative validation through testing and reuse, and the abstraction of code into frameworks for instantiation and reuse. Literal code can be abstracted. These abstractions can in turn yield similar codes, which serve to verify their patterns. There is a taxonomy of representations from the lowest-level literal codes to their highest-level natural language descriptions. As a result, product quality is improved in proportion to the degree of reuse at all levels of abstraction. Any software that is, in theory, complex enough to allow for self-reference, cannot be certified as being absolutely valid. The best that can be attained is a relative validity, which is based on testing. Axiomatic, denotational, and other program semantics are more difficult to verify than the codes, which they represent! But, are there any limits to testing? And how can we maximize the reliability of software or hardware products through testing? These are essential questions that need to be addressed; and, will be addressed herein.

Book excerpt: An expanded and updated edition of a comprehensive presentation of the theory and practice of model checking, a technology that automates the analysis of complex systems. Model checking is a verification technology that provides an algorithmic means of determining whether an abstract model—representing, for example, a hardware or software design—satisfies a formal specification expressed as a temporal logic formula. If the specification is not satisfied, the method identifies a counterexample execution that shows the source of the problem. Today, many major hardware and software companies use model checking in practice, for verification of VLSI circuits, communication protocols, software device drivers, real-time embedded systems, and security algorithms. This book offers a comprehensive presentation of the theory and practice of model checking, covering the foundations of the key algorithms in depth. The field of model checking has grown dramatically since the publication of the first edition in 1999, and this second edition reflects the advances in the field. Reorganized, expanded, and updated, the new edition retains the focus on the foundations of temporal logic model while offering new chapters that cover topics that did not exist in 1999: propositional satisfiability, SAT-based model checking, counterexample-guided abstraction refinement, and software model checking. The book serves as an introduction to the field suitable for classroom use and as an essential guide for researchers.
